West Cambridge Conservation Area

West Cambridge is a substantial conservation area in England, covering approximately 195.3 hectares of protected landscape. It is designated in 1972 during the initial wave of conservation area protection, reflecting the area's longstanding cultural and architectural significance. The area contains 92 listed buildings, highlighting its exceptional concentration of heritage assets.

At 195.3 hectares, this is a large conservation area — significantly bigger than the UK average of around 45 hectares.

What restrictions apply in West Cambridge?
Properties in West Cambridge Conservation Area may face restrictions on demolition, tree work (6 weeks' notice required), and certain exterior alterations. Contact your local planning authority for specific rules that apply here.
